  • I handmade a minimalist ring using 14 karat rose gold wire and a rose cut moissanite center stone. Documenting the process from start to finish.
    Materials used: 1.50mm wire, solder, and a 5mm colorless rose cut moissanite.

      I know this is late but a wire braid is easy. Just use a lighter gauge than here and make sure your wire is well annealed, and re-anneal as needed. You can put the ends in a vice, a pin vice or a spring clip to hold them. The braid can be as tight or loose as you want. This is wire....it stays where it’s put. Obviously the smaller the gauge the tighter it can be braided. When you have enough braid, measure what you need (using a ring mandrel), cut, solder, and finish.
